Impact

In addition to changing the hunting perimeter, S3194 imposes new responsibilities on property owners who wish to engage in hunting on their land. These owners must now provide written notice to neighboring property owners and occupants at least 24 hours before any hunting activity takes place. This transparency aims to inform and protect those living nearby from potential hazards associated with hunting, thereby fostering a greater sense of community safety.

Summary

Bill S3194, known as the 'Restoring Safety Buffer Law', alters hunting regulations in New Jersey to enhance safety near occupied buildings and school playgrounds. It specifically expands the previously existing prohibition of hunting activities with a bow and arrow from a 150-foot radius to a 450-foot radius of such buildings. This adjustment aims to mitigate risks associated with hunting in proximity to residential areas and educational institutions, ensuring that individuals and their pets, like the unfortunate case of Tonka, a pet mistakenly shot, are afforded greater protection.

Contention

While supporters of S3194 highlight its potential to prevent tragic incidents similar to the shooting of Tonka, critics may argue that increased restrictions on hunting could infringe on the rights of lawful hunters and limit traditional hunting practices. The requirement of neighborly notification could also complicate the process for hunters, creating friction between recreational users of land and private property owners. Hence, the bill underscores a balancing act between safety concerns and the rights of individuals engaging in hunting.
